WebMar 26, 2024 · The Hawaiian word for water is wai; the word for law is kānāwai, showing us that the regulation of water has been a fundamental concept of Hawaiian law since ancient times. We should now recognize the wisdom of the ancient Hawaiian and readopt the principle that the water must be regulated for the benefit of the people. [32]
